oracle - 每天 TB 大小的存档存储空间
问题描述
我正在研究 Oracle DB。每天归档存储高达 TB 级别。我需要解决这个问题。如何检测导致数据库变化最大的表达式(dml + ddl)?您可以使用此图像进行检查。
解决方案
有日志挖掘pl/sql,可以在oracle中开启,sql可以看到archivelog的内容,然后就可以知道这些archivelog是什么生成的。
请参阅以下链接(但您需要以 dba 角色启用和跟踪归档日志的内容)
https://docs.oracle.com/cd/B19306_01/server.102/b14215/logminer.htm
斯科特
推荐阅读
- python - 保存图形时 Matplotlib 未正确显示直方图
- c# - 写入位置访问冲突,线程之间共享变量
- arangodb - ArangoDB AQL:查找顺序数据中的差距
- azure - Azure Monitor 是否将警报发布到 RSS 源或消息队列或主题?我们可以创建一个订阅模型来自己接收警报吗?
- flutter - 在 Flutter 中点击图标时如何打印出图标名称
- tcl - Eggdrop 上带有 API 的 Youtube 脚本未显示正确的字符集
- amazon-s3 - Redshift External Table 所有字段为空
- c - 我不知道如何编写关于金字塔的 C 代码
- apache-kafka - 如何重命名/替换 Kafka-connect SMT 结构中的字段?
- python - 将另一列添加到现有列表